Accedian has partnered with Quali to help service providers and enterprises ensure seamless digital experiences as they undergo transitions and migrations often associated with performance and security risks.
Accedian and Quali, working with their system integrator and channel partners, will deliver a new offering, Secure and Fast, to their global customers. In this solution, Accedian's SkyLIGHT combines advanced network flow monitoring, real-time application transaction capture and end user experience tracking as part of Secure and Fast's full stack performance and security posture assessments.
Secure & Fast combines Quali's Cloudshell Pro with Accedian's SkyLIGHT PVX unified NPM/APM solution and Cavirin's CyberPosture Intelligence, a security and compliance solution for hybrid infrastructures. It promotes collaboration and enables organizations to simplify application and cloud rollouts, automate and expedite deployment processes, validate cybersecurity postures, and gain visibility into resource usage and potential performance impacts - all in a replicable and secure sandbox environment before going `live' with any changes or updates.
The benefits for enterprises and service providers include:
- Faster delivery of physical, virtual and cloud infrastructure for new products and services
- Real-time monitoring of application performance and transaction times across multi-cloud environments
- Ability to pinpoint the root-causes of performance degradations
- Comprehensive visibility into the impact to overall system security posture
- Risk-free, lab-as-a-service tests of SDN and 5G network slices
